25 //
26 // For CompiledIC's:
27 //
28 // In cases where we do not have MT-safe state transformation,
29 // we go to a transition state, using ICStubs. At a safepoint,
30 // the inline caches are transferred from the transitional code:
31 //
32 // instruction_address --> 01 set xxx_oop, Ginline_cache_klass
33 // 23 jump_to Gtemp, yyyy
34 // 4 nop
